Bourbon Fizz

Acadiana • Washington, D.C. Acadiana’s bartenders serve this drink with pecan-flavored praline liqueur. Sazerac.com has sources for the liqueur, but the combination of amaretto and Frangelico approximates the taste (not really).

* SERVINGS: 1 drink
Ingredients

1. Ice
2. 1 1/2 ounces bourbon
3. ½ ounce Praline liquor or 1/4 ounce amaretto 1/4 ounce Frangelico
5. 1/2 ounce Simple Syrup
6. 1 ounce chilled club soda

Directions
1. Rinse a martini glass with the pastis. Moisten the outer rim of the glass with the lemon wedge and coat lightly with sugar. Fill a cocktail shaker with ice and add the bourbon, amaretto, Frangelico and Simple Syrup. Shake and strain into the martini glass. Top with the club soda.
